Transaction def8c8a7cb551a3cdb94bc4019f17f0bf303ae9a184d7dc5931c1007353309f3
1 Input
1 Output
-
def8c8a7cb551a3cdb94bc4019f17f0bf303ae9a184d7dc5931c1007353309f3:0
- value
- 150743
- script pubkey
- OP_0 OP_PUSHBYTES_20 520afa90bb5294d50944b446933e1e3e82f7e2b7
- address
- bc1q2g904y9m222d2z2yk3rfx0s786p00c4hcaff9n